Job Summary:
We're looking for a highly organised and proactive HGV Workshop & Repairs Co-ordinator to coordinate all planned and reactive maintenance activities across our diverse heavy goods vehicle fleet. You'll play a vital role in ensuring our fleet is serviced, repaired, and roadworthy -- keeping downtime to a minimum and compliance at the forefront. You will be responsible for the smooth and effective planning of all workshops bays, monitoring and reporting on the efficiency of the team internally and ensuring external maintenance is carried out as scheduled.
Key Responsibilities
Schedule routine servicing, MOTs, inspections, as well as running repairs for HGVs and trailers
Allocate jobs to internal technicians and external repair agents ensuring compliance with O Licence and manufacturer guidelines
Monitor VOR (Vehicle Off Road) status and prioritise urgent repairs to ensure fleet availability
Maintain workshop calendars and ensure technician workloads are balanced and fully utilised
Track job progress, parts orders, and completion times liaising with operations and management teams to provide regular updates.
Liaise with transport and compliance teams to align maintenance with operational needs
Ensure all work schedules comply with DVSA standards and Operator Licence undertakings
Ensure WIP jobcards are managed with all labour and stock allocated and charged correctly
